Safe checks before repair
A known-good comparison is valuable only when its specification is correct. Similar-looking cables and parts can use different wiring or protocols. For this All-in-One Computer LCD Panel problem, all-in-one computers can contain exposed mains-power sections and retained charge. High-load testing is limited until airflow, fan operation and temperature sensing have been confirmed.
Repair approach
Once incorrect replacement specification is confirmed, replace the panel only after its model, voltage, connector and mounting are matched. The fault-specific action is to fit the exact compatible assembly and recheck for damage caused by the mismatch. A successful first startup is not the finish; the triggering condition needs to be tested again in a controlled way. Firmware and calibration are changed only when required by the confirmed part and supported by the manufacturer.
